Geometry Dash 7-8 Asomeness: A Comprehensive Scratch Platformer
Geometry Dash 7-8 Asomeness is a feature-rich, community-created platformer built on Scratch that expands the thrilling Geometry Dash experience. This installment challenges you with two intense levels centered on the core mechanics of precise timing, jumping, and navigating past hazardous spikes.
Flexible Controls & Core Gameplay
Choose your preferred control method to guide your icon: use the [up] arrow key, W, [space], or a simple mouse click to execute jumps. Contact with the distinctive yellow rings also propels you forward. The primary objective remains clear: avoid all spikes to survive and progress.
Diverse Game Modes & Mechanics
The gameplay dynamically shifts into ship mode, where control changes to a "hold to fly up, release to fly down" mechanic, testing your aerial precision. For powerful vertical boosts, actively seek out the yellow pads for high jumps and the even more potent blue pads for massive leaps—a note for veterans: this version operates without the typical gravity portal interaction. Scattered throughout the levels are coins to collect, offering bonus points for players aiming for a perfect score.
Performance Optimization & Extended Content
Understanding the demands of browser-based games, this project includes a crucial performance feature: press the L key to toggle visual effects on and off. This can drastically reduce lag and ensure smoother gameplay on various systems.
